The Last thing we need is another injury- Arne Slot ahead of Liverpool’s FA Cup Clash

Liverpool FC head coach Arne Slot is dreading the thought of having another player in his team pick up an injury and miss time.

The Reds are dealing with injuries to Jeremie Frimpong, Alexander Isak, Giovanni Leoni and Conor Bradley and recently had midfielder Wataru Endo forced off in Liverpool’s 1-0 win over Sunderland in the English Premier League.

Leoni and Bradley are likely to miss the rest of the season due to an ACL injury and knee ligament damage respectively.

Slot shared this fear ahead of Liverpool’s FA Cup tie against Brighton and Hove Albion at Anfield on Saturday, February 14 at 20:00 GMT.

“We’ve got three priorities – FA Cup, Champions League qualification and the Champions League – but we’re also aware of the limited options I have, we have, in terms of the squad.”

“So, the load management is important as well because the last thing we could use right now is another injury” Slot said according to the club’s media.
